抚养

Chinese HSK 7-9 Vocabulary Chinese ★★ 2/5 formal fǔ yǎng
Pinyin fǔ yǎng
Hanzi breakdown 抚 = 扌 + 无 (nurture, care for); 养 = 羊 + 食 (raise, support, nourish)

Meaning

To raise; to bring up; to support and care for a child or dependent until they are self-sufficient.

Used in legal and familial contexts for the responsibility of raising children. More formal than 养 alone. Often appears in family law discussions, divorce proceedings, and formal statements about parental responsibility.

Examples

  1. 依据法律规定,父母双方均有义务抚养未成年子女。 Under the law, both parents have an obligation to support their minor children.
  2. 她离婚后独自抚养两个年幼的孩子,生活十分不易。 After the divorce, she raised two young children on her own, and life was very difficult.
  3. 这对夫妻协议离婚,约定孩子由母亲抚养,父亲定期探视。 The couple agreed to divorce, with the child to be raised by the mother and the father granted regular visitation.

Usage Guide

Context: legal, family

Tone: neutral

Do Say

  • 祖父母无法代替父母履行抚养子女的法定义务。(Grandparents cannot substitute for parents in fulfilling the legal obligation to raise children.)
  • 他虽然与妻子分居,但仍承担着抚养三个孩子的责任。(Although he lives separately from his wife, he still bears the responsibility of raising three children.)

Don't Say

  • 抚养一只狗 — 抚养 in formal and legal usage refers to children or dependents; use 养 or 饲养 for pets
